Manufacturing Quality Control of N,N,2-trimethylquinolin-6-amine

Detection Item Common Analytical Method Method Overview
Assay (Purity) HPLC-UV Quantification by peak area comparison against a certified reference standard using reversed-phase chromatography and UV detection at 254 nm.
Related Substances HPLC-DAD Separation and identification of impurities based on retention time and UV spectral match relative to reference standards or threshold limits.
Residual Solvents GC-FID Volatile organic solvents quantified by flame ionization detection after headspace or direct injection, calibrated with standard solutions.
Moisture Content Karl Fischer Titration Coulometric or volumetric titration using iodine generation in pyridine-free reagent; water reacts stoichiometrically with iodine and sulfur dioxide.
Heavy Metals (Total) ICP-OES Multi-element detection of Pb, Cd, Hg, As, Cr after acid digestion; emission intensities measured at element-specific wavelengths.
Chloride Impurity Ion Chromatography Quantitative separation and conductivity detection of chloride anions using anion-exchange column and sodium carbonate eluent.
Sulfated Ash Gravimetric Analysis Sample incinerated at 600-700 C, treated with sulfuric acid, then ignited to constant weight; residue mass expressed as percentage.
Melting Point Capillary Melting Point Apparatus Solid sample heated gradually in capillary tube; onset and clear point determined optically per USP <741>.
Appearance Visual Inspection Assessment of color and physical state (crystalline powder) against standard reference under controlled white light and defined viewing conditions.
Specific Optical Rotation Polarimetry Measurement of rotation angle of plane-polarized light at 20 C using sodium D-line (589 nm); reported as [alpha]D20.
Residue on Ignition Gravimetric Analysis Mass loss upon high-temperature ignition (700-800 C) followed by weighing of non-volatile residue; indicates inorganic impurities.
pH of Aqueous Suspension pH Meter pH measured in 1:10 w/v suspension in purified water using calibrated electrode; reflects acidic/basic impurity content.
